Leaders and members of cooperative societies under Sirsa Cooperative Marketing and Processing Society Ltd. have submitted a memorandum to the Hafed district manager, opposing the recent reduction in commission rates, media reports say.
Led by Chairman Rohtash Poonia, they termed Hafed’s decision unfair and damaging to cooperative sustainability.
The delegation demanded reversal of the cut in paddy commission to Rs 1.33 per quintal and sought higher rates for wheat, fertiliser, and anganwadi transport. They warned that if their demands were ignored, state-wide protests could follow.
